The Pre and Post Processing (GiD) Group at CIMNE develops GiD, a universal pre and post-processing software that streamlines simulation workflows with advanced geometry, meshing, and visualization tools for science and engineering

CIMNE’s Pre- and Post-Processing (GiD) research group, integrated within the DIGIT Innovation Unit, is exclusively dedicated to the continuous development and refinement of GiD, a leading pre- and post-processing software for numerical simulations in science and engineering. GiD offers a universal, adaptive, and user-friendly environment that covers the entire simulation workflow—from geometric modelling and mesh generation to data assignment and advanced result visualization.

The group’s expertise spans computational geometry, CAD tool development, and robust mesh generation techniques, enabling efficient handling of complex models across diverse numerical methods such as finite element, finite volume, and meshless approaches. GiD’s CAD system supports NURBS surfaces, automatic geometry repair, and seamless integration with a wide range of solvers, making it highly versatile for both research and industrial applications.

A key strength of the GiD Group lies in its focus on customization and interoperability. Users can tailor the software to their specific needs, automate simulation workflows, and connect in-house or commercial solvers with ease. The group also pioneers advanced post-processing features, offering powerful 3D visualization, animation, and data export capabilities, even for large-scale, high-performance computing scenarios.

GiD is offered for both Scientific and Business purposes, offering tailored solutions for training, scientific research, and professional needs.

Through its commitment to applied innovation and technology transfer, the GiD Group empowers engineers and researchers to transform complex data into actionable insights, driving progress across multiple engineering disciplines and contributing to CIMNE’s mission of impactful digital transformation. The group leads periodical conventions, aimed at users and developers, to showcase the latest advancements of the GiD software and gather community input.

Research areas

Computational Geometry

Computer Aided Design (CAD) tools development to cover numerical simulation tools.

Mesh Generation

Development and improvement of mesh generation tools for numerical simulations, covering the needs of all CIMNE groups devoted to numerical simulations, as well as the GiD users.

Postprocessing for Numerical Simulations

Development of advanced postprocessing techniques for numerical simulations, specially for cases of huge distributed results focused on High Performance Computing (HPC) architectures.

Advanced Visualization

Advanced 3d visualization techniques adapted for numerical simulations, considering very big models and sets of results, as well as remote solutions to allow the use of light devices (mobile) for visualizing simulations adapted to cloud architectures.

Software Architecture

• Design of Graphical User Interface (GUI) for simulation software, and customization of solvers to be integrated in GiD pre and postprocessing platform.
• Adaptation of cloud architectures to cover the needs of simulation software, and implementation of a new platform for simulations based on Software as a Service (Saas) business model paradigm.
